加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.dadazhan.cn/)- 数据安全、安全管理、数据开发、人脸识别、智能内容!
当前位置: 首页 > 运营中心 > 网站设计 > 设计教程 > 正文

PHP设计实战:逻辑与美学并重的网站构建

发布时间:2026-06-16 15:58:25 所属栏目:设计教程 来源:DaWei
导读:  PHP作为一门历经二十多年演进的Web开发语言,早已超越了“能用就行”的初级阶段。在现代网站构建中,它既是逻辑引擎,也是美学载体——代码结构决定系统可维护性,而模板组织、资源加载与交互响应方式,直接塑造

  PHP作为一门历经二十多年演进的Web开发语言,早已超越了“能用就行”的初级阶段。在现代网站构建中,它既是逻辑引擎,也是美学载体——代码结构决定系统可维护性,而模板组织、资源加载与交互响应方式,直接塑造用户感知的视觉节奏与操作温度。


  逻辑清晰始于分层设计。将业务规则封装进Service类,数据访问交由Repository抽象,控制器仅负责协调与响应,这种三层解耦让修改登录策略不影响商品展示,调整支付网关不牵连前端渲染。例如用户头像上传,逻辑上需校验格式、尺寸、病毒扫描、存储路径生成与数据库记录更新;若全部堆砌在控制器里,不仅难以复用,更会在需求变更时引发连锁错误。拆解后,每个环节职责单一,测试边界明确,协作效率自然提升。


  美学并非仅靠CSS实现,而是贯穿于PHP输出的每一处细节。使用Twig或Blade等模板引擎,避免原生PHP混写HTML带来的结构混乱;通过组件化设计(如可复用的分页器、面包屑导航、表单字段宏),确保UI一致性的同时,降低设计师与前端工程师的沟通成本。更重要的是,PHP可主动优化页面加载体验:按需预加载关键CSS、内联首屏样式、生成响应式图片srcset属性、甚至结合WebP支持自动降级——这些都不是静态文件能完成的,而是服务端动态决策的结果。


  性能与安全是逻辑与美学的共同基石。未过滤的用户输入直接插入SQL或HTML,既可能引发注入漏洞,也会导致页面布局错乱(如未转义的尖括号破坏DOM结构);而过度缓存或忽略HTTP缓存头,则会让用户看到过期内容,破坏界面信息的时效性与可信感。PHP内置的filter_var()、PDO预处理、htmlspecialchars()等工具,应成为每处输入输出的默认守门人;同时,利用OPcache加速字节码执行,配合Redis缓存高频查询结果,让流畅体验成为常态而非例外。


AI辅助设计图,仅供参考

  真正的实战智慧,在于拒绝“技术炫技”与“视觉堆砌”。一个电商详情页,不必用复杂路由渲染数十个AJAX片段,而可用PHP一次组装完整HTML,辅以轻量JS增强交互;后台管理界面无需追求动画特效,但应通过表单验证反馈、操作成功提示、错误定位高亮等细节,传递出稳定、可信赖的系统气质。代码是否优雅,不在于用了多少新特性,而在于他人阅读时能否三秒理解意图;界面是否美观,不取决于色彩多丰富,而在于用户能否零思考完成核心任务。


  PHP设计实战的本质,是让逻辑成为美学的骨架,让美学成为逻辑的表达。当一段处理订单的代码既健壮又易读,当一个按钮点击后既响应迅速又动效克制,当错误提示既准确又温和——技术便完成了从工具到体验的升维。这无关框架选择,而在开发者心中是否始终并置着两把标尺:一边丈量正确性,一边感知人性。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章